Output e31240f53a9e3449bac9a83a74510bc178573c1fe6a8c9dca94abdda72d30608:0

value
76009099
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d7d8ecb4a34f5f57ecd236758eea7ea9cee5177 OP_EQUALVERIFY OP_CHECKSIG
address
184jSgPURdkFuucKL4NYXY3kY2na2CtUJd
transaction
e31240f53a9e3449bac9a83a74510bc178573c1fe6a8c9dca94abdda72d30608
spent
true